Spreadtrum to Integrate Hantro Multi-Format Video Solution into their Next Generation 3G TD-SCDMA Baseband IC
Building on the successful partnership, in which Spreadtrum previously integrated Hantro’s 4550 and 5550 to their mass produced SC6800 series 2.5G GSM/GPRS baseband chip, this new agreement enables Spreadtrum to realise an extremely competitive and highly integrated multimedia entertainment baseband IC for the 3G TD-SCDMA market. The solution will provide handset manufacturers with the ideal platform for developing the devices needed for volume penetration of the 3G market in China.

The SC8800 series with Hantro’s multi-format codec will be commercially available in the second half of 2006.
About Spreadtrum Communications
Spreadtrum Communications Inc. is a leading fabless semiconductor company that develops and markets innovative wireless communications products. Spreadtrum provides high-performance, low-cost products, including 2.5G/3G baseband IC, protocol stack software, application software, wireless communication module and total solutions for worldwide wireless terminal manufactures, independence design houses, and semiconductor companies. Spreadtrum successfully developed world’s first TD-SCDMA baseband chip and Asia’s first 2.5G (GSM/GPRS) baseband chip. Spreadtrum’s true Single-chip Solution has great advantages such as high performance with low-cost, fast market entry for customers, reduced time-to-market and effective local customer support.
